Abstract
The fiber collecting groove is located at the largest inside diameter of the rotor and is formed by two surfaces which define an angle of aperture .alpha. from 45.degree. to 90.degree.. The bottom of the groove is of a radius of from 0.1 to 0.5 millimeters. Also, the bisector of the angle of aperture .alpha. forms an angle .beta. with the plane of rotation of the groove of a value from 0.degree. to 45.degree. while the yarn take-off direction forms an angle with the plane of rotation of from 0.degree. to 25.degree.. Trash accumulations are reduced to a minimum without detrimentally effecting yarn quality.
